    lacelace1 /leɪs/ noun 查看全部语言翻译1 [uncountable] a fine cloth made with patterns of many very small holes由极细小的孔眼组成花纹图案的精致织物:  a handkerchief trimmed with lace镶有蕾丝花边的手帕 lace curtains蕾丝窗帘2[countable usually plural] a string that is pulled through special holes in shoes or clothing to pull the edges together and fasten them穿过鞋子或衣物上专用孔眼、用于收拢边缘并系紧的细带 SYN  shoelace
    lacelace2 verb [transitive] 1 (also lace up) to fasten something by tying a lace用带子系紧某物 SYN  tie:  Lace up your shoes or you’ll trip over.系好你的鞋带,否则你会绊倒的。lace something to something The canvas was laced to a steel frame.帆布用绳带系在了钢架上。2to add a small amount of alcohol or a drug to a drink在饮料中加入少量酒精或药物lace something with something coffee laced with Irish whiskey加了爱尔兰威士忌的咖啡3to weave or twist several things together将数样东西编织或扭结在一起lace something together Hannah laced her fingers together.汉娜把双手手指交叉相扣。lace something with something phrasal verb1to include something all through something you write or say在写作或话语中自始至终穿插某事物:  He laces his narrative with a great deal of irrelevant information.他在叙述中大量穿插了无关紧要的信息。2be laced with something written书面 to have some of a quality带有某种特质:  Iris’s voice was heavily laced with irony.艾里斯的声音充满了强烈的讽刺意味。
